Which 2 railroad linked up at Promontory Utah to create the first transcontinental railroad?

The two railroads that linked up at Promontory, Utah to create the 1st transcontinental railroad were the Union Pacific Railroad and the Central Pacific Railroad.

Benefits of Chinese imperialism on America?

1. There never was any "imperialism" on the part of the Chinese. 2. They came to America (the first large immigrations) to mine for gold, during California's Gold Rush of 1849. 3. Being available for mass labor, they helped build America's first transcontinental railroad which hooked up with the mostly Irish built portion of the railroad at Promontory Point in Utah in 1869. 4. Being available for more hard work, and with the gold fields used up, and the railroads built...the Chinese built the levy system in California's Sacramento Valley.
